DOB: January 2021Meet Pearl:

Rescued with her sister Gracie, precious Pearl comes out to say “hi” whenever we approach her slowly before scampering off to play with some catnip toys. When she’s not playing, she’s sitting on a warm window ledge beside Gracie, engrossed in “bird and squirrel” TV. Eager to make up for lost time and lost love, purr-ty Pearl will truly gleam in a patient home with room in their hearts for both Gracie and her.
